• vs+opencv 使用过程中所遇问题记录 day1


    Q1.

     运行图像读取测试程序,提示如下,且不显示图像

    “t12.exe”(Win32):  已加载“C:UsersNEODocumentsVisual Studio 2013Projects 12Debug 12.exe”。已加载符号。

    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64 tdll.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64kernel32.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64KernelBase.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64msvcp120d.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64opencv_highgui2413d.dll”。无法查找或打开 PDB 文件。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64msvcr120d.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64opencv_core2413d.dll”。无法查找或打开 PDB 文件。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64user32.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64gdi32.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64ole32.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64combase.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64msvcrt.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64 pcrt4.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64sspicli.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64cryptbase.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64cryptprimitives.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64sechost.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64oleaut32.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64advapi32.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64msvfw32.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64avicap32.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64avifil32.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64shell32.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64cfgmgr32.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64winmm.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64msacm32.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64windows.storage.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64shlwapi.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sWinSxSx86_microsoft.windows.common-controls_6595b64144ccf1df_5.82.10586.0_none_811bc0006c44242bcomctl32.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64kernel.appcore.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64SHCore.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64winmmbase.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64winmmbase.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64powrprof.dll”。已加载符号。
    “t12.exe”(Win32):  已卸载“C:WindowsSysWOW64winmmbase.dll”
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64profapi.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64imm32.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64uxtheme.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64msctf.dll”。已加载符号。
    “t12.exe”(Win32):  已加载“C:WindowsSysWOW64dwmapi.dll”。已加载符号。
    线程 0x63c 已退出,返回值为 0 (0x0)。
    线程 0x2394 已退出,返回值为 0 (0x0)。
    线程 0x2548 已退出,返回值为 0 (0x0)。

    程序“[10972] t12.exe”已退出,返回值为 0 (0x0)。

    A:提示中的未加载可以忽略,出现此种情况原因基本为图像路径问题,尝试将路径设置为绝对路径,注意区分"/" ""

    imread不支持相对路径(我把图片放在工程里还是失败),只支持绝对路径,并且不支持“”路径分隔符,支持“\”, “/”或"//"分割符

    Q2:上图中好多.dll未加载。工具--选项--调试--符号--符号服务器打钩,问题解决

    http://blog.163.com/chenpeijie0_0/blog/static/1830945712011780275118/另一种解决方案。

  • 相关阅读:
    OpenGL搭建环境-VS2012【OpenGL】
    IOS内存约定-【ios】
    bootstrap下jQuery自动完成的样式调整-【jQuery】
    如何访问https的网站?-【httpclient】
    twitter typeahead控件使用经历
    grails服务端口冲突解决办法-【grails】
    jQuery中live函数的替代-【jQuery】
    如何自动设置网页中meta节点keywords属性-【SEO】
    如何在grails2.3.x中的fork模式下进行调试?-【grails】
    树的简介及Java实现
  • 原文地址:https://www.cnblogs.com/neo3301/p/13169883.html
Copyright © 2020-2023  润新知